We Must Prepare with Utmost Seriousness: Nairi Hokhikyan

Journalist Nairi Hokhikyan writes: “The current state of Armenian-Azerbaijani relations does not inspire any optimistic hope that we will soon have stable peace or at least that there will be no war. The Secretary of the National Security Council of Armenia has convincingly and vigorously declared that the process with Azerbaijan has not reached a deadlock. This clearly indicates that the process is indeed at a standstill, and the recent phone conversation between Erdoğan and Pashinyan was not coincidental.

I believe the Turkish president has presented ultimatums to Nikol Pashinyan in exchange for a peace treaty and the opening of borders; otherwise, Azerbaijan may be pushed back onto the battlefield at any moment. Let us not forget that before the war in 2020, Nikol Pashinyan referred to Ilham Aliyev as cultured and peace-loving. We must also remember that the enemy has now constructed new military units near the front line.

In these circumstances, Turkey and Great Britain desperately need a military escalation in our region. This would open a second front for Russia. Geopolitical processes and the fifth division of the world cannot bypass us. We must prepare with utmost seriousness for unforeseen events.”
